Imagine receiving a direct message from Ripple’s former chief technology officer—a figure synonymous with the early promise of decentralized payments. The account looks verified, the profile photo matches, and the tone carries the authoritative calm of a tech visionary. But there is a 90% chance, as the ex-CTO himself now warns, that this message is a sophisticated impersonation designed to drain your wallet. The number is jarring—not because impersonation scams are new, but because the source is a senior alumni of one of crypto’s most recognized companies, and the platform is Instagram, a centralized social network where millions of crypto users transact trust daily.
This is not a story about a smart contract exploit or a flash loan attack. It is a glaring reminder that the weakest link in crypto’s security chain is not code—it is identity. When I first entered the space in 2017, dissecting 0x Protocol’s whitepaper, I believed that permissionless systems would automatically eliminate intermediaries and their associated fraud. Seven years of industry observation, including deep dives into failed DAOs and collapsed L2 projects, have taught me that while blockchain removes the need for a central bank, it does not remove the need for trust in who you are talking to. The impersonation warning from Ripple’s former CTO is a canary in the coal mine for a problem the community has largely ignored: we are building decentralized financial rails atop centralized identity infrastructure, and that mismatch is becoming exploitable.
Context: Why This Warning Matters Beyond One Scam
The individual issuing the warning—let us call him the ex-CTO emeritus—spent years shaping Ripple’s technical strategy and has no direct stake in the company’s current marketing. His public estimate that nine out of ten Instagram accounts claiming to be Ripple executives are fraudulent is not hyperbole; it is a data point drawn from his own monitoring of the platform. Ripple, as a company, has been a frequent target of impersonators because of the global recognition of its brand and its native token XRP. But the problem extends far beyond one firm. In my work auditing economic models for Web3 startups, I have seen how easily social capital—a founder’s reputation, a protocol’s Twitter following—becomes a weapon against users. The same architecture that makes crypto permissionless also makes identity verification optional, and that optionality is now being gamed at scale.
From a game theory perspective, the impersonation scam is a perfect example of information asymmetry. The scammer knows they are fraudulent; the victim does not. The platform (Instagram) has the ability to verify accounts but often fails to do so proactively, especially for executives who are not paying for premium verification tiers. The result is a negative-sum game: the scammer extracts value, the victim loses funds, and the entire ecosystem’s trust erodes slowly. During the 2022 bear market, when I published my “Anatomy of a Collapse” series analyzing FTX and Celsius, the common thread was not a technical flaw in the blockchain but a failure of accountability—centralized actors hiding behind opaque identities. Now, with AI-generated deepfakes, the impersonation threat is multiplying. The ex-CTO’s warning feels like a preemptive strike against a coming wave of synthetic identity fraud.
Core Insight: The Architecture of Trust Is Broken—And Only On-Chain Identity Can Fix It
Let me be precise. The blockchain industry has spent billions scaling transaction throughput, reducing gas fees, and implementing zero-knowledge proofs. These are noble technical achievements. Yet the fundamental human problem—how do I know you are who you claim to be—remains unsolved. The current trust model for crypto interactions relies on a fragile hybrid: blockchain for value transfer, but centralized platforms for identity verification. When you trade on a DEX, you trust the smart contract. But before that trade, you likely discovered the project through Twitter, Telegram, or Instagram—platforms where impersonation is trivial. This is not scaling; it is layering fragility.
Based on my experience translating complex governance proposals for MakerDAO’s Chinese community, I have seen firsthand how reputation systems collapse under centralization. In 2020, a small group of us organized Shanghai’s first DeFi meetup. We relied on personal introductions and shared community forums to ensure attendees were genuine. As the community grew, impersonation became common—fake “community managers” would DM new members asking for private keys. We eventually implemented a simple on-chain verification step: attendees minted a soulbound token after proving their identity through a video call. The process was cumbersome but eliminated impersonation entirely. This anecdote illuminates a broader truth: the most effective anti-scam tool is not a better firewall but a verifiable, decentralized identity tied to behavior.
Imagine a world where every crypto executive—every spokesperson for a protocol—registers a cryptographic identity on-chain, linked to their official social accounts via a signed message. When you receive a DM, you can check that the public key matches the one published on the project’s ENS or on a decentralized registry. The ex-CTO’s warning would become moot because the platform itself becomes unnecessary as a trust anchor. This is not a futurist fantasy. Ethereum Name Service, Handshake, and emerging DID standards like Iden3 already provide the primitives. The barrier is adoption: projects are reluctant to enforce identity requirements because they believe it conflicts with the pseudonymous ethos of crypto.
I counter that pseudonymity is a luxury for users, not a shield for scammers. The original vision of blockchain was to enable trustless economic coordination, not to create a wild west where impersonation is a feature. When I audited the incentive models of a failed Layer 2 project last year, I discovered that its entire community treasury was drained by a fake Discord admin who had exploited a server invite link. The project’s code was perfect—ZKP verified, formally proven—but the social layer was unprotected. Code is law, but people are the soul. Without a reliable way to map identities to agents, the system remains vulnerable to the oldest attack in the book: social engineering.
Contrarian Angle: The Warning Itself Is a Distraction
Now, let me play devil’s advocate. Some will argue that the ex-CTO’s 90% figure is a self-serving exaggeration designed to boost his own security-as-a-service venture or to position himself as a thought leader. They will point out that the real problem is not crypto but Instagram’s lax moderation, and that the solution is platform-side verification, not blockchain. This perspective has merit: centralized platforms could solve impersonation overnight by requiring stricter identity checks for crypto-related accounts. But here is the blind spot: centralized platforms have no incentive to protect crypto users specifically, and they often profit from engagement, even fraudulent engagement. Instagram’s parent company, Meta, has been notoriously slow to act on crypto scams because removing them reduces ad revenue. Relying on a corporation to solve a problem that undermines its own business model is naive.
Furthermore, the contrarian might claim that the warning could actually increase panic and make users more susceptible to phishing—if people are already scared, they may click malicious links in fake “security” messages. This is a valid psychological concern, but it does not negate the need for a systemic fix. The real risk is not the warning itself but the absence of a structural response. The crypto community loves to chase the next billion-dollar scaling solution, yet we ignore the million-dollar identity problem that bleeds trust daily. If we continue to build on centralized identity rails, we are building castles on sand.
